Virgin Voyages Unveils “VoyageFair Choices” — New Cruise Fares Made Simple

Virgin Voyage fair Choices
COURTESY OF VIRGIN VOYAGES

Virgin Voyages just made a major shake-up to how its cruises are priced. With the launch of VoyageFair Choices, Sailors now have clearer options, more flexibility, and a transparent look at what’s included before they ever step onboard.


🌟 What’s Changing

Starting October 7, 2025, all new bookings for Sea Terrace and below cabins will fall under one of three new fare tiers:

  • Base – the lowest price, but also the least flexible.

  • Essential – most similar to the current Virgin fare.

  • Premium – includes the most perks, flexibility, and even a built-in Bar Tab.

RockStar & Mega RockStar Suites will continue with their existing perks, but get earlier dining reservations (up to 120 days out).

🍽️ Dining Reservation Flexibility

Virgin Voyages is known for its foodie-forward approach, and now, when you can book those hot tables depends on your tier:


  • Base: 15 days before sailing

  • Essential: 45 days before sailing

  • Premium: 60 days before sailing

  • Suites: 120 days before sailing


💳 Gratuities Made Clear

Instead of being bundled in, gratuities are now shown as a separate line item:

  • $20 per Sailor per night if prepaid

  • $22 per Sailor per night if paid onboard

Virgin says this change doesn’t impact total price — it just makes comparisons with other cruise lines easier. Importantly, there’s still no tipping expected once onboard.


⚓ What’s Not Changing

Sailors will still enjoy Virgin’s Always Included Luxury:✅ Specialty dining✅ Soda, still & sparkling water✅ Fitness classes✅ World-class entertainment✅ Wi-Fi (tier depends on fare)

And Virgin confirms crew pay remains unaffected by this shift.



🎯 Cruise Ship Crayz Takeaway

This move puts Virgin closer to what travelers already see with airlines and hotels. It adds transparency, highlights what’s included at each level, and keeps the onboard vibe tips-free and worry-free.


For travel advisors, the new tiers will make quoting Virgin easier and more competitive against mainstream cruise lines. For Sailors, it’s all about choosing how much flexibility (and Wi-Fi speed!) you want.
